About Ms. Walker’s Services
Speech services are provided to students who have been identified by the school system as having deficits in: articulation, phonology, voice, fluency, and/or language.


Objectives of Speech Services
Each student receiving services has his/her own objectives based on identified areas of need. The factors that influence selection of target objectives include: academic performance, overall educational needs, and current level of functioning. My personal objective is to constantly create, as well as take advantage of, opportunities to enhance the communication of my students.
